Candy In Modern Culture

In modern times, candy has become a booming industry that continues to grow. To maintain the industry, companies continue to invent creative flavors and forms of candy to appeal to buyers. Sometimes, new candies are not even made to be enjoyed. For example, Jelly Belly has created a game called BeanBoozled out of jelly beans. The game involves each color of jelly bean having two flavors associated with it, one good, one bad. When you pull a jelly bean, you do not know what flavor you get, you just hope for the good one. Some of the flavors are absolutely vile, ranging from toothpaste to barf. Other flavors of candy have been taken to extremes as well in the form of sour candies. On the other side, candy companies have become more innovative, with brands like M&Ms making a variety of fillings for their chocolate candies like brownie batter, pretzels, peanut butter and jelly, and cold brew caramel flavoring. These examples only provide some insight to the way the candy industry has continued to develop to meet the desires of the changing human race.
